Bitcoin is stirring conversation among the investment community as questions rise about whether now is the optimal time to buy. With recent market changes, several people are weighing in on the pros and cons of entering the market.

Discussion Highlights

Market Sentiment: A range of opinions have emerged, with tension around timing and strategy. Some community members express a feeling that the price is not compelling for buying at the moment.

One comment pointedly stated, "I saw someone ask this question when it was 17k as well. Kinda sounds like now is a good time to sell Bitcoin, then." This indicates skepticism among some people about capitalizing on current buying opportunities.

Key Considerations for Investors

When contemplating purchases, a few important themes arise from user discussions:

  • Timing is Crucial: Several users emphasized the importance of deciding when to sell as foundational to determining when to buy. A user noted, *"When you’re considering an investment, the first and most important thing you need to consider is 'when will I sell this'?"

  • Long-Term View: There are advocates who believe that Bitcoin will appreciate indefinitely. One comment reflects this mindset: *"Anytime is a good time, for it is ordained to increase in value exponentially forever."

  • Value Perspective: Some opinions contribute to the view that many still consider Bitcoin a bargain. A standout comment declares, "Everything under a million is a bargain."
